About S. A. Goryaynov

S. A. Goryaynov is a scholar working on Genetics, Biophysics and Radiology, Nuclear Medicine and Imaging, having authored 44 papers that have together received 382 indexed citations. Recurring topics across this work include Glioma Diagnosis and Treatment (22 papers), Meningioma and schwannoma management (9 papers), Advanced Neuroimaging Techniques and Applications (9 papers), Spectroscopy Techniques in Biomedical and Chemical Research (8 papers), Advanced MRI Techniques and Applications (6 papers), MRI in cancer diagnosis (5 papers), Nanoplatforms for cancer theranostics (5 papers) and Brain Metastases and Treatment (4 papers). The work is most often cited by research in Genetics (185 citations), Biophysics (42 citations) and Radiology, Nuclear Medicine and Imaging (117 citations). S. A. Goryaynov has collaborated with scholars based in Russia, Italy and United States. Frequent co-authors include Potapov Aa, Galina Pavlova, Aldo Spallone, D A Gol'bin, А. И. Баталов, Victor B. Loschenov, Maria Goldberg, Igor Pronin, Н. Е. Захарова and A. V. Revishchin.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and International Journal of Molecular Sciences.
